Wholesale process Start-Finish

Lorenzo Hatten
  • Frederick, MD
Posted
Hello all, I have a list of 20 buyers right now. I have details on what they are looking for and what they are looking to spend. Iv reached out to local Maryland Investor friendly title companies. I have about 3k to place as a deposit. More if need be. So from the order of things and what I have gathered here on BP. 1) I should start running numbers on properties? 2)I should place an offer on what seems to be a good deal? So far am I in track? Next I'm assuming I would need to put the property under contract and I'll have about 60 days to secure a end buyer. (Based on time frame specified in contract) So far am I taking the right steps forward to securing my first RE deal?
